The plasticity of ageing and the rediscovery of ground-state prevention.
History and philosophy of the life sciences - 4 May 2021
Blasimme Alessandro
Abstract excerpt
In this paper, I present an emerging explanatory framework about ageing and care. In particular, I focus on how, in contrast to most classical accounts of ageing, biomedicine today construes the ageing process as a modifiable trajectory. This framing turns ageing from a stage of inexorable decline into the focus of preventive strategies, harnessing the functional plasticity of the ageing organism. I illustrate...
